APA Co. (NASDAQ:APA – Free Report) – Scotiabank reduced their FY2025 earnings per share estimates for APA in a note issued to investors on Wednesday, March 19th. Scotiabank analyst P. Cheng now expects that the company will earn $3.20 per share for the year, down from their previous estimate of $3.80. The consensus estimate for APA’s current full-year earnings is $4.03 per share.

About APA
APA Corporation, an independent energy company, explores for, develops, and produces natural gas, crude oil, and natural gas liquids. It has oil and gas operations in the United States, Egypt, and North Sea. The company also has exploration and appraisal activities in Suriname, as well as holds interests in projects located in Uruguay and internationally.
